(45,013 posts)50. After Entering Not Guilty Plea, Knight Enters A Hospital
Last edited Sat Feb 28, 2015, 11:20 PM - Edit history (1)
CNN: ...Marion "Suge" Knight pleaded not guilty Tuesday to murder charges in a fatal hit-and-run incident...Knight, 49, stood in a defendant's box next to his attorneys and intently read the complaint against him as the hearing opened.
Later in the session, Knight was transported to a hospital after saying he was having chest pains...
Outside the courthouse, Knight's attorney David Kenner told reporters..."It's too early to tell, but clearly from what I understand, he was being attacked and trying to get away from that attack, no more than that..."
The man who died was Terry Carter, 55, a former rap record label owner. The second man is Cle "Bone" Sloan, 51. Knight felt remorseful about the death and the injury in the incident, Kenner said...Carter and Knight were friends..."They've known each other for a long time," the attorney...added...
Sloan's attorney, Michael Shapiro, said Tuesday that his client is in shock and has suffered a serious concussion and might not be able to walk again...(He) dismissed (Knight's) version of events...(as) "absurd..."
